Where Will Tilray Brands Be in 5 Years?
Is it worth buying the stock and hanging on until at least 2028?
Tilray Brands(TLRY -3.38%) won’t hit $4 billion in revenue by 2024. The company has scrapped that target.
But it hasn’t given up on growth as it continues to look for ways to expand. Whether it’s th…